The case it involves Dolabella data and the model Marcela Tomaszewski had repercussions again after new images came to light. A friend of the model, identified as Rafa Clementewho lives in Spain, used his social networks this Sunday (26/10) to denounce the actor and show the alleged recordings of the attacks. In the videos published, Marcella appears with visible bruises on the body and the finger immobilized. Rafa accused the artist of physical and verbal violence, calling him a “attacker”.
The images were released later Marcella she publicly denied being assaulted by Giveneven after a video of the fight was leaked. In the recordings following the conflict, the model appears with a red neck and hand, while a female voice speaks to the actor. During the dialogue you can hear the artist say “he deserved it”without clarifying who he was referring to. In response, Marcella answers: “I must have deserved it too for asking you to put less salt in your food”to whom Given he replies ironically: “Yes, that’s why”.
Friend reports and asks for public help
On social media, Rafa Clemente she harshly criticized the actor and revealed that she had been blocked Marcella after trying to get her to delete the videos while denying the attacks. “Since Dolabella is the aggressor! It is useless to joke with those who have people. You will go to jail, you coward!!! And you, Marcela, who blocked me for telling you to delete your stories, lying and saying that he had not attacked you, I will publish here everything you sent me about the attack”he wrote.
The friend also asked people in Brazil to report the case. “Yes, there is no point in denying it, yes, there was an attack. Everyone in Brazil, report it to the nearest Deam. Marcela lives in Rio de Janeiro”has appealed. He claimed to have done so “all the evidence of the attacks and the traces of the conversations”and explained that anyone can file a domestic violence report, which “automatically initiates a process under the Maria da Penha law”. Rafa concluded by saying that the process did not start immediately, “even after the neighbor called the police because of the screaming during the attacks”.
